Transaction c070454cb995944b8045c6de4e8d1680f89eb566abe39cadbe69a87dcdf22cc4
1 Input
1 Output
-
c070454cb995944b8045c6de4e8d1680f89eb566abe39cadbe69a87dcdf22cc4:0
- value
- 476466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15fda333fa28c8ba89e70d17e8f2b633ec9150b5 OP_EQUAL
- address
- 33hHxceh6jye55Po71fUsuEP6cLCukiV7e